On 6/17/26 21:14, Timur Kristóf wrote:
> We should only reset the memory controller during ASIC reset
> and only when it's absolutely necessary. Otherwise, resetting
> the memory controller typically just breaks everything and
> on dGPUs may also clear the contents of VRAM (it's unclear if
> it really does, but it's likely).
> 
> Specifically for GMC 8, the memory controller is reset as part
> of the ASIC reset and otherwise should be left alone.
> 
> Signed-off-by: Timur Kristóf <[email protected]>

I'm a bit suprised that gmc_v8_0_mc_stop is removed as well, but yeah it is 
clearly unused now as well.

I never touched this code, so I think Alex should take a look as well.

Acked-by: Christian König <[email protected]>

Regards,
Christian.
